Stage monitoring speakers play a vital role in the world of live sound, especially for musicians and performers. These speakers are designed specifically to provide real-time audio feedback to artists on stage, allowing them to hear themselves and their fellow musicians clearly. Understanding how stage monitoring speakers function and their importance can significantly enhance the quality of live performances.
In a live music environment, artists need to be aware of their sound, timing, and dynamics. This is where stage monitoring speakers come into play. They help mitigate the challenges posed by the acoustics of the venue and the potential for sound delays. Unlike standard speakers that project sound to the audience, stage monitors are strategically positioned on the stage, directing sound towards the performers. This arrangement ensures that the artists receive a balanced mix of vocals and instruments, which is crucial for delivering a cohesive performance.
There are different types of stage monitoring speakers available, including wedge monitors, in-ear monitors, and personal monitor systems. Wedge monitors are the traditional choice, angled to direct sound towards the performer while remaining unobtrusive. On the other hand, in-ear monitors provide a more personalized listening experience by delivering sound directly into the artist’s ears, allowing for greater sound isolation and reducing the volume needed on stage. Personal monitor systems enable musicians to control their mix, ensuring they hear exactly what they need in various performance settings.
The quality of stage monitoring speakers can greatly impact the overall performance. High-quality speakers deliver a clear and balanced sound, allowing performers to make necessary adjustments during a live set. This is particularly important for vocalists, who rely on their monitors to stay in tune and maintain their timing with other instruments. The subtle nuances in sound provided by good stage monitors can be the difference between a great performance and a mediocre one.
When considering stage monitoring solutions, it is essential to think about factors such as speaker placement, volume levels, and the type of monitoring system that best suits your needs. Additionally, understanding the acoustics of the venue can help in optimizing the setup for the best sound experience.
